Archangelos Studio

  • Free Wi-Fi
  • Air conditioning
  • Pets allowed
Location

Archangelos Studio Strovolos is located 10 minutes by car from the Metochi of Kykkos and 6 km from the Ledra Street Crossing Point.

The airy Selimiye Mosque is within 7 km of this apartment.

You can prepare meals of your choice in the comfort of Archangelos Studio in an equipped kitchen. The nearest bus stop to the apartment is Agiou Eleftheriou - Agiou Ioannou Chrysostomou, which is around 5 minutes' walk away.

9.5
Exceptional
Based on 6 reviews
Important information
Check-in: from 14:00 until 23:00
Check-out: from 08:00 until 11:00